    Fields related to piety

    Philosophy

    In philosophy, piety can be explored as a virtue related to respect, duty, and ethical behavior.

    Literature

    In literature, piety is often portrayed through characters who exhibit deep religious or moral devotion.

    History

    In historical contexts, piety may be discussed in relation to the practices and beliefs of different cultures and time periods.

    Religion

    In the context of religion, piety refers to devotion and reverence towards a higher power or deity.
